Abstract
Infections by the hepatitis B or hepatitis C virus are extremely common causes of acute and chronic liver disease, and coexistence of the two viruses is not uncommon. Both of two diseases, together or alone, are important health problem on the world. Here, in a patient with chronic hepatitis C virus infection who developed acute hepatitis B virus infection was reported. She was in trouble because of skipped hepatitis B vaccination. The patient have been recommended to receive vaccinations against hepatitis B. Patients with chronic hepatitis C should immunized against hepatitis B virus and even hepatitis A virus. Whole chronic hepatitis B patients also should be evaluated for hepatitis A vaccine. In this paper, due to a case, were asked to draw attention to the importance of vaccination.
